Find desktop app equivalents

If you want to successfully switch to using a tablet as your laptop replacement, you should carefully examine your laptop use and see if you can reduce your processing power and resources usage.

There are many smartphone apps that offer desktop versions of the same programs. For example, if you use Microsoft Word, Excel or Powerpoint, you can find mobile versions of these programs that perform all the functions most users require. The same goes for editing photos, videos and other typical computing tasks. ..

Connect a mouse and keyboard

To pair your Bluetooth devices, follow these steps:

  1. Open the Android app and find the Bluetooth menu.
  2. Scroll down to find the devices you want to pair.
  3. Tap on one of the devices to Pair it with.

Some tablets have a proprietary keyboard connector that you can use with a removable keyboard sold by the same company or one of their partners. In some cases, this keyboard effectively turns the tablet into something similar to a laptop form factor.
